Message type: E = Error
Message class: FAA_MD - Fixed Asset Master
Message number: 124
Message text: It is not possible to delete a depr area because the asset is capitalized
You tried to delete a depreciation area from asset &V2& in company code
&V1&.
However, once an asset is capitalized in at least one accounting
principle<(>,<)> this is <ZH>not</> allowed.
The process is terminated.
If you don?t need the valuation for this depreciation area in the asset
master record anymore, you can post a full retirement to it.
The system issues an error message and will not allow you to continue with this transaction until the error is resolved.

- It is not possible to delete a depr area because the asset is capitalized ?The SAP error message FAA_MD124 indicates that you are trying to delete a depreciation area for an asset that has already been capitalized. This typically occurs in the context of asset accounting (FI-AA) when you attempt to modify or delete a depreciation area that is linked to an asset that has been capitalized in the system.
Cause: Capitalization Status: The asset has been capitalized, meaning that it has been fully processed in the system, and its financial data is already recorded. Depreciation Area: The depreciation area you are trying to delete is associated with the asset's capitalized value, which prevents its deletion. Data Integrity: SAP enforces data integrity rules to ensure that financial records remain consistent and accurate. Deleting a depreciation area from a capitalized asset could lead to inconsistencies in financial reporting.
